At the heart of minimalist bedroom design are simplicity and functionality. Start with a neutral color palette—think soft whites, warm grays, and muted earth tones—to create a calming backdrop. Incorporate natural materials like linen, wood, and stone for texture without clutter. Opt for built-in storage solutions and multi-functional furniture to maintain clean lines. Avoid decorative overload; each piece should serve a purpose or bring joy. This intentional approach ensures your bedroom becomes a haven of order and peace.

Even small bedrooms can feel expansive with strategic minimalist choices. Use wall-mounted shelves and floating nightstands to free up floor space. Choose a platform bed with sleek legs to enhance airflow and visibility. Mirrors strategically placed reflect light and amplify the sense of space. Keep window areas unobstructed with sheer, lightweight curtains. These subtle yet impactful touches maintain visual lightness while elevating the room’s aesthetic—proving minimalism thrives on thoughtful detail, not absence of furniture.

Lighting and texture play pivotal roles in minimalist bedroom harmony. Soft, layered lighting—such as dimmable overhead fixtures paired with warm bedside lamps—sets a soothing mood. Natural light should be welcomed through sheer, uncluttered window treatments. Texturally, layer textured throws, organic cotton linens, and smooth ceramic decor to add depth without chaos. Neutral tones grounded in nature foster relaxation, while occasional muted accents—like a single plant or a subtle piece of art—bring warmth and personality, completing the tranquil experience.
